Minimalist ultrasound levitator
This code is a simplification of the minilev.ino Asier Marzo version (http://www.instructables.com/id/Acoustic-Levitator/).
This algorithm is optimized to use only a pair of ultrasonic transducers facing each other and an Arduino Nano, using software interruptions of an 80 kHz timer, and toggling the state of the pins.
If using HC-SR04 sensor transducers, be sure to use the emission transducers with a T marked on the back.

Connect one transducer to A0 and A1; and another transducer to A2 and A3.
Put the transducers opposite to each other to levitate a particle between them, it is easier to place the particle with a metallic grid.
